Right, you have a divide-by-zero error. Why? Because you're reusing the variable col! I told you it was a bad idea. :)
See, the first time the loop comes through, the counting variable col is zero, so you get a div-by-zero error. If you use a different variable for the counting variable, col will always be equal to COL -- and away you go.

ok I got it fixed now, I have one more problem though. The new array is kept as a float throughout the entire program. Why aren't my numbers printing in the single dimension array as floats?
-
Because in this line
Code:
average = (float)(total/ROW);
you're casting to float too late. The integer division has already taken place. Try using
Code:
average = ((float)total) / ROW;
or
Code:
average = (float)total / ROW;
See, you have to cast one of the operands to a float before the division takes place, or, as I already mentioned, you get an int which you then cast to a float, which is rather redundant.
